Display locks up - [drm:i915_hangcheck_elapsed] *ERROR* Hangcheck timer elapsed... render ring idle

Bug #1455785 reported by jippie
24
This bug affects 4 people
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Expired
Low
Unassigned

Bug Description

I've been running Kubuntu 14.04.2 LTS for about a year with no problems. Problem started about 3 months ago or so.
- The screen usually locks up when using Firefox, today it happen when I switched windows from Firefox to Konsole (the GUI app). The screen locked half way switching the window borders from blue to grey. The konsole window border on my right monitor is was grey, is now locked faint blue and should have turned to full blue. The Firefox window on the left monitor was full blue, is now slightly going to grey and locked right there and then.
- When the system is locked, which happens every two or three weeks, I can sometimes change to text console but not always. Currently I cannot access console, but I can log in to the box through SSH. Screen blanking (power save) doesn't work when the screen locked. When my box locks up, I usually run full patching before power cycle, some messages in log files may be caused by that.

[vr mei 15 23:12:46 2015] [drm:i915_hangcheck_elapsed] *ERROR* Hangcheck timer elapsed... render ring idle
[vr mei 15 23:15:36 2015] INFO: task Xorg:2243 blocked for more than 120 seconds.
[vr mei 15 23:15:36 2015] Tainted: G OX 3.13.0-49-generic #83-Ubuntu
[vr mei 15 23:15:36 2015]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
[vr mei 15 23:15:36 2015] Xorg D ffff88023bd134c0 0 2243 2230 0x00400000
[vr mei 15 23:15:36 2015] ffff8800b29d7a18 0000000000000086 ffff88022a6d1800 ffff8800b29d7fd8
[vr mei 15 23:15:36 2015] 00000000000134c0 00000000000134c0 ffff88022a6d1800 ffff880035523000
[vr mei 15 23:15:36 2015] ffff880035472ad8 ffff880035eda800 ffff880035eda800 ffff8800032da780
[vr mei 15 23:15:36 2015] Call Trace:
[vr mei 15 23:15:36 2015] [<ffffffff81725f49>] schedule+0x29/0x70
[vr mei 15 23:15:36 2015] [<ffffffffa015ea65>] intel_crtc_wait_for_pending_flips+0x75/0x110 [i915]
[vr mei 15 23:15:36 2015] [<ffffffff810ab120>] ? prepare_to_wait_event+0x100/0x100
[vr mei 15 23:15:36 2015] [<ffffffffa017008f>] intel_crtc_set_config+0x7ef/0x9a0 [i915]
[vr mei 15 23:15:36 2015] [<ffffffffa0026eed>] drm_mode_set_config_internal+0x5d/0xe0 [drm]
[vr mei 15 23:15:36 2015] [<ffffffffa00a4561>] drm_fb_helper_set_par+0x71/0xf0 [drm_kms_helper]
[vr mei 15 23:15:36 2015] [<ffffffff813cd181>] fb_set_var+0x191/0x430
[vr mei 15 23:15:36 2015] [<ffffffff810a2f60>] ? update_curr+0x80/0x180
[vr mei 15 23:15:36 2015] [<ffffffff813da161>] fbcon_blank+0x1d1/0x2d0
[vr mei 15 23:15:36 2015] [<ffffffff81462d68>] do_unblank_screen+0xb8/0x1f0
[vr mei 15 23:15:36 2015] [<ffffffff81458aba>] complete_change_console+0x5a/0xe0
[vr mei 15 23:15:36 2015] [<ffffffff81459aea>] vt_ioctl+0xfaa/0x11c0
[vr mei 15 23:15:36 2015] [<ffffffff8144d4cd>] tty_ioctl+0x26d/0xbb0
[vr mei 15 23:15:36 2015] [<ffffffff811ffcd1>] ? fsnotify+0x241/0x320
[vr mei 15 23:15:36 2015] [<ffffffff811d1200>] do_vfs_ioctl+0x2e0/0x4c0
[vr mei 15 23:15:36 2015] [<ffffffff811c0521>] ? __sb_end_write+0x31/0x60
[vr mei 15 23:15:36 2015] [<ffffffff811d1461>] SyS_ioctl+0x81/0xa0
[vr mei 15 23:15:36 2015] [<ffffffff8173263d>] system_call_fastpath+0x1a/0x1f

ProblemType: Bug
DistroRelease: Ubuntu 14.04
Package: linux-image-3.13.0-52-generic 3.13.0-52.86
ProcVersionSignature: Ubuntu 3.13.0-52.86-generic 3.13.11-ckt18
Uname: Linux 3.13.0-52-generic x86_64
ApportVersion: 2.14.1-0ubuntu3.10
Architecture: amd64
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C0: jhendrix 3776 F.... pulseaudio
CurrentDesktop: KDE
Date: Sat May 16 17:32:37 2015
InstallationDate: Installed on 2013-08-13 (640 days ago)
InstallationMedia: Kubuntu 13.04 "Raring Ringtail" - Release amd64 (20130424)
IwConfig:
 eth0 no wireless extensions.

 lo no wireless extensions.
ProcFB: 0 inteldrmfb
ProcKernelCmdLine: BOOT_IMAGE=/vmlinuz-3.13.0-52-generic root=/dev/mapper/vg_diablo-system ro quiet splash nomdmonddf nomdmonisw nomdmonddf nomdmonisw nomdmonddf nomdmonisw vt.handoff=7
RelatedPackageVersions:
 linux-restricted-modules-3.13.0-52-generic N/A
 linux-backports-modules-3.13.0-52-generic N/A
 linux-firmware 1.127.11
RfKill:
 0: hci0: Bluetooth
  Soft blocked: no
  Hard blocked: no
SourcePackage: linux
UpgradeStatus: Upgraded to trusty on 2014-04-26 (385 days ago)
dmi.bios.date: 04/06/2010
dmi.bios.vendor: Intel Corp.
dmi.bios.version: GTG4310H.86A.0031.2010.0406.1752
dmi.board.asset.tag: To be filled by O.E.M.
dmi.board.name: DG43GT
dmi.board.vendor: Intel Corporation
dmi.board.version: AAE62768-301
dmi.chassis.type: 3
dmi.modalias: dmi:bvnIntelCorp.:bvrGTG4310H.86A.0031.2010.0406.1752:bd04/06/2010:svn:pn:pvr:rvnIntelCorporation:rnDG43GT:rvrAAE62768-301:cvn:ct3:cvr:

Revision history for this message
jippie (jph4dotcom) wrote :
Revision history for this message
jippie (jph4dotcom) wrote :

I disabled desktop effects for the moment, because some articles on Internet point in that direction and also the lock up clearly happened during the fading effect from one window to the other, as described above.

Revision history for this message
jippie (jph4dotcom) wrote :
Revision history for this message
Brad Figg (brad-figg) wrote : Status changed to Confirmed

This change was made by a bot.

Changed in linux (Ubuntu):
status: New → Confirmed
Revision history for this message
penalvch (penalvch) wrote :

jippie, thank you for reporting this and helping make Ubuntu better. As per https://downloadcenter.intel.com/product/41036/Intel-Desktop-Board-DG43GT an update to your computer's buggy and outdated BIOS is available (0035). If you update to this following https://help.ubuntu.com/community/BIOSUpdate does it change anything?

If it doesn't, could you please both specify what happened, and provide the output of the following terminal command:
sudo dmidecode -s bios-version && sudo dmidecode -s bios-release-date

For more on BIOS updates and linux, please see https://help.ubuntu.com/community/ReportingBugs#Bug_reporting_etiquette .

Please note your current BIOS is already in the Bug Description, so posting this on the old BIOS would not be helpful. As well, you don't have to create a new bug report.

Once the BIOS is updated, and the information above is provided, then please mark this report Status New.

Thank you for your understanding.

tags: added: bios-outdated-0035
Changed in linux (Ubuntu):
importance: Undecided → Low
status: Confirmed → Incomplete
description: updated
Revision history for this message
chris pollock (cpollock) wrote :
Download full text (32.6 KiB)

I have the same problem now with the video freezing while using Firefox although the [drm:i915_hangcheck_elapsed] *ERROR* Hangcheck timer elapsed... render ring idle error is no longer present. Per request from Chris Wilson on the Intel-Gfx mailing list I am running kernel 4.0.0-997-generic #201503310205 SMP Tue Mar 31 02:07:04 UTC 2015 x86_64 x86_64 x86_64 GNU/Linux and also xf86-video-intel driver version 2.99.917. I'm running the most current BIOS for my system - Dell OptiPlex 780 System BIOS A15

chris@localhost:~$ sudo lshw
[sudo] password for chris:
localhost
    description: Mini Tower Computer
    product: OptiPlex 780 ()
    vendor: Dell Inc.
    serial: G20PBM1
    width: 64 bits
    capabilities: smbios-2.5 dmi-2.5 vsyscall32
    configuration: administrator_password=enabled boot=normal chassis=mini-tower power-on_password=enabled uuid=44454C4C-3200-1030-8050-C7C04F424D31
  *-core
       description: Motherboard
       product: 0C27VV
       vendor: Dell Inc.
       physical id: 0
       version: A01
       serial: ..CN137400250867.
     *-firmware
          description: BIOS
          vendor: Dell Inc.
          physical id: 0
          version: A15
          date: 08/06/2013
          size: 64KiB
          capacity: 8128KiB
          capabilities: pci pnp apm upgrade shadowing escd cdboot bootselect edd int13floppytoshiba int13floppy720 int5printscreen int9keyboard int14serial int17printer acpi usb biosbootspecification netboot
     *-cpu
          description: CPU
          product: Intel(R) Core(TM)2 Duo CPU E8400 @ 3.00GHz
          vendor: Intel Corp.
          physical id: 400
          bus info: cpu@0
          slot: CPU
          size: 3GHz
          width: 64 bits
          clock: 1333MHz
          capabilities: x86-64 fpu fpu_exception wp v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 clflush dts acpi mmx fxsr sse sse2 ss ht tm pbe syscall nx constant_tsc arch_perfmon pebs bts rep_good nopl aperfmperf pni dtes64 monitor ds_cpl vmx smx est tm2 ssse3 cx16 xtpr pdcm sse4_1 xsave lahf_lm dtherm tpr_shadow vnmi flexpriority
          configuration: cores=2 enabledcores=2 threads=2
        *-cache:0
             description: L1 cache
             physical id: 700
             size: 128KiB
             capacity: 128KiB
             capabilities: internal write-back unified
        *-cache:1
             description: L2 cache
             physical id: 701
             size: 6MiB
             capacity: 6MiB
             capabilities: internal varies unified
     *-memory
          description: System Memory
          physical id: 1000
          slot: System board or motherboard
          size: 4GiB
        *-bank:0
             description: DIMM DDR3 Synchronous 1066 MHz (0.9 ns)
             product: M378B5673EH1-CF8
             vendor: Samsung
             physical id: 0
             serial: 94C3C095
             slot: DIMM_1
             size: 2GiB
             width: 64 bits
             clock: 1066MHz (0.9ns)
        *-bank:1
             description: DIMM DDR3 Synchronous 1066 MHz (0.9 ns)
             product: M378B2873EH1-CF8
             vendor: Samsung
             physical i...

Revision history for this message
chris pollock (cpollock) wrote :
Revision history for this message
Launchpad Janitor (janitor) wrote :

[Expired for linux (Ubuntu) because there has been no activity for 60 days.]

Changed in linux (Ubuntu):
status: Incomplete → Expired
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.